Understanding the Features and Functions of Culvert Sleeves
Culvert sleeves are the latest development in drainage solutions, consisting of high-density polyethylene (HDPE) or reinforced concrete materials designed to fit over existing culverts. They serve as a protective barrier while improving flow capacity and water quality. Key features of culvert sleeves include:
- Durability: Made from corrosion-resistant materials, culvert sleeves can withstand harsh weather and resist degradation from chemical exposure.
- Streamlined Design: The smooth interior of the sleeves promotes enhanced water flow, reducing clogging and sediment accumulation.
- Retrofitting Capability: Culvert sleeves can easily be installed over existing culverts without the need for extensive excavation, allowing for efficient upgrades to drainage systems.
These core functions make culvert sleeves a compelling option for municipalities and urban planners.
Advantages and Application Scenarios
The use of culvert sleeves brings numerous advantages to urban drainage systems, including:
- Improved Water Quality: By minimizing sediment buildup and enhancing water flow, culvert sleeves help maintain cleaner water in local waterways.
- Cost-Effective: Their design allows for quick installation and minimal maintenance, which can lead to reduced long-term costs compared to traditional culvert systems.
- Versatile Applications: Culvert sleeves can be utilized in various scenarios, including urban roadways, highway drainage, agricultural runoff collection, and even during an emergency response to flooding situations.
